ResourceBundle.getString حرف مائل إزالة
-
06-07-2019 - |
سؤال
وحاولت الحصول على مورد من مسار الملف من ملف الممتلكات.
وملف العقار:
info_path=c:\Info\output
وجافا:
String path = ResourceBundle.getBundle("bundle_name").getString("info_path");
والنتيجة: C: Infooutput
وأود أن الحاجة إلى تعيين الملف:
info_path=c:\\Info\\output
هل هذا هو السلوك الافتراضي؟ أم أنه يعتمد على ترميز الملف؟ ملف يستخدم الترميز SJIS جانب الطريق.
المحلول
وأنت أفضل من استخدام قدما خفض في ملفات الممتلكات الخاصة بك، بدلا من بعض الحل. بالمناسبة مهما كنت على يونيكس / لينكس أو ويندوز، مائل يعمل بشكل جيد، في هذا السياق على الأقل. بعد كل شيء جافا منصة مستقلة. ؛)
<اقتباس فقرة>وP.S. على نحو أفضل لاستخدام مسار نسبي.
اقتباس فقرة>لا تنتمي إلى StackOverflow